Every app in this category has a free tier. They differ enormously in whether that tier is usable or just a demo.

Shopify’s own bulk editor and CSV import are free and unlimited, so “free bulk editing” already exists. What the free tiers of apps offer is the part Shopify lacks — rules, scheduling and undo — in small quantities.
Competitor pricing and features below were checked on the Shopify App Store on 2026-08-20. Apps change; verify before deciding.
| Option | Free tier | Usable for real work? |
|---|---|---|
| Shopify native editor | Unlimited, manual values only | Yes, for typing values by hand |
| Bulk Product Edit by MITS | 5 tasks/month, 10 items per task | As a filters-and-editors trial |
| Hextom | 10 products per task | As a trial |
| Ablestar | 10 products per task | As a trial |
| Platmart | 1 task/month, 100 products | One small job a month |
| syncX Stock Sync | 2,000 products, 1 feed, manual | Yes, for a small feed |
Ten items per task is small; it is also enough to see exactly how the app behaves.

A store with a few hundred products that changes prices twice a year can get a long way on the free tier, running five small tasks a month. What the paid plans add is volume, the scheduler, recurring tasks and task history — the filters and editors themselves are the same everywhere.
Free plan, then $3.99, $7.99 and $14.99 per month. Plans differ by products per task, tasks per month, recurring schedules and how long task history is kept.
